Things to Do around Polmont

Polmont, a village situated within the Falkirk area of Scotland, presents a varied landscape suitable for outdoor pursuits. The region features a blend of historical canals, significant engineering structures, and natural woodlands, providing diverse terrain for activities. Its network of paths and waterways supports several sports like touring cycling, road cycling, hiking, jogging, and more.

What natural features and landmarks can be seen in Polmont?

Polmont's landscape includes the Avon Aqueduct, Polmont Woods, and sections of the Roman Antonine Wall. Nearby attractions include the Falkirk Wheel and The Kelpies. Cockleroy Hill Summit offers panoramic views.

What types of terrain are found on Polmont's cycling routes?

Polmont's cycling routes feature varied terrain, ranging from mostly paved surfaces along canals to some unpaved and more challenging segments within areas like Polmont Woods. The Union Canal towpath offers a firm, accessible surface.

Are there jogging routes in Polmont?

Polmont offers several jogging routes, including the 'Avon Aqueduct Run,' which is nearly 6 miles [10 km] and mostly flat alongside the aqueduct. Polmont Woods also provides paths suitable for runs. The Running Trails around Polmont guide lists additional options.
